A court that allows persons eligible under the rules in article 4 to have remote access to electronic records must have an identity verification method that verifies the identity of, and provides a unique credential to, each person who is permitted remote access to the electronic records. A person eligible to remotely access electronic records under the rules in article 4 may be given such access only if that person: (1) Provides the court with all of the information it needs to identify the person to be a user; (2) Consents to all conditions for remote access required by article 4 and the court; and.
